About The Road Warrior
George Miller's 1981 masterpiece The Road Warrior (also known as Mad Max 2) stands as one of the most influential action films ever made. Set in a desolate post-apocalyptic Australian wasteland where gasoline has become the most precious commodity, the film follows the iconic Max Rockatansky (Mel Gibson) as he reluctantly agrees to help a small, fortified community defend their precious fuel supply against a horde of savage, marauding bandits led by the menacing Lord Humungus.
Mel Gibson delivers a career-defining performance as the world-weary, cynical drifter whose humanity slowly reawakens through his interactions with the desperate community. The film's direction by George Miller is nothing short of brilliant, creating a visceral, gritty world that feels both terrifyingly real and mythically epic. The practical stunts and vehicular mayhem remain breathtaking even by today's standards, with chase sequences that have been endlessly imitated but never surpassed.
What makes The Road Warrior essential viewing is its perfect blend of relentless action, compelling character development, and world-building. The film established countless post-apocalyptic tropes while maintaining a raw, emotional core. The sparse dialogue and visual storytelling create a cinematic experience that transcends language and culture.
